Editorial Reviews

From Booklist

It is Cassidy-Li’s turn to be her kindergarten class’ “star of the week,” so she begins her autobiographical poster with a photograph taken in China at the time of her adoption. Other snapshots introduce her American family, friends, and favorite activities; but Cassidy-Li ruefully realizes she does not have a photograph of her birth family: “I think about my birth parents a lot. Sometimes I miss them.” Her questions and longings go into a picture she draws for her poster. Realistic illustrations portray a contemporary family bearing a strong resemblance to that of the author, the illustrator, and their daughter in the book-flap photo. The pictures add character and a light touch to a story, which, while upbeat, deals forthrightly with the uncertainties of adoptees. Cassidy-Li’s thoughts and questions about her birth family will resonate with adopted children and serve as a springboard for discussion in homes and classrooms. Preschool-Grade 3. --Linda Perkins


Product Description

It's Cassidy—Li's turn to be Star of the Week at school! So she's making brownies and collecting photos for her poster. She has pictures of all the important people in her life—with one big exception. Cassidy—Li, adopted from China when she was a baby, doesn't have a photo of her birthparents. But with a little help from her family, she comes up with the perfect way to include them!

Using their own family's story as a model, Darlene Friedman and Roger Roth celebrate the love of families everywhere through this straightforward and insightful book.

5.0 out of 5 stars A Beautiful Way to Handle Difficult Conversations, June 18, 2009
Darlene Friedman and Roger Roth are a great team. The writing and illustrations in this book communicate a loving and sensitive story of a child's quest to come to terms with her adopted past...not an easy subject. As a teacher, I see this book as a vehicle for self discovery for my students. The story presents many meaningful writing opportunities for students to explore who they are and how their roots have an impact on their lives. As a parent, I think this book can show how difficult situations can be approached with love and honesty. I enjoyed the book very much, and I highly recommend it to adults and children of all ages.

5.0 out of 5 stars A WONDERFUL BOOK FOR ALL!!, June 4, 2009
Immediately after I read Star of the Week, I emailed Ms. Friedman to thank her and her husband for such a "lovely, touching, fun and honest book that I look forward to reading with my adopted son." I also wrote that I hope they "collaborate on more adoptive picture books in the future!"

As a teacher of second graders for over thirteen years, I know how difficult "Star of the Week" can be for some students. I believe Ms. Friedman's book will help open up the lines of communication for my son and others as well as show how wonderful and special the "Star of the Week" experience can be!

Today I am going to buy three more copies for my friends who also have children they adopted from Russia.

Thanks again Ms. Friedman!!!
